Persian New Wave films shared some characteristics with the European art films of the period, in particular Italian Neorealism. However, in her article ‘Real Fictions’, Rose Issa argues that persian films have a distinctively persian cinematic language”that champions the poetry in everyday life and the ordinary person by blurring the boundaries between fiction and reality, feature film with documentary.”
